Telcagepant (INN; development code MK-0974) is a calcitonin gene-related peptide receptor antagonist which was an investigational drug for the acute treatment and prevention of migraine, developed by Merck & Co.
In the acute treatment of migraine, it was found to have equal efficacy to rizatriptan and zolmitriptan.
